summaryrefslogtreecommitdiff
path: root/tests/scanner/regress.c
diff options
context:
space:
mode:
Diffstat (limited to 'tests/scanner/regress.c')
-rw-r--r--tests/scanner/regress.c15
1 files changed, 14 insertions, 1 deletions
diff --git a/tests/scanner/regress.c b/tests/scanner/regress.c
index a940a199..3c186238 100644
--- a/tests/scanner/regress.c
+++ b/tests/scanner/regress.c
@@ -2101,7 +2101,8 @@ enum
PROP_TEST_OBJ_DOUBLE,
PROP_TEST_OBJ_STRING,
PROP_TEST_OBJ_GTYPE,
- PROP_TEST_OBJ_NAME_CONFLICT
+ PROP_TEST_OBJ_NAME_CONFLICT,
+ PROP_TEST_OBJ_BYTE_ARRAY,
};
static void
@@ -2690,6 +2691,18 @@ regress_test_obj_class_init (RegressTestObjClass *klass)
PROP_TEST_OBJ_NAME_CONFLICT,
pspec);
+ /**
+ * TestObj:byte-array:
+ */
+ pspec = g_param_spec_boxed ("byte-array",
+ "GByteArray property",
+ "A contained byte array without any element-type annotations",
+ G_TYPE_BYTE_ARRAY,
+ G_PARAM_READWRITE | G_PARAM_CONSTRUCT);
+ g_object_class_install_property (gobject_class,
+ PROP_TEST_OBJ_BYTE_ARRAY,
+ pspec);
+
klass->matrix = regress_test_obj_default_matrix;
}